Lifesaving skipper formally recognized by Coast Guard

                   GUAM – Coast Guard Cmdr. Yuri Graves, the deputy commander of Sector Guam, officially recognizes and pins on the Meritorious Public Service Award on Edward Ratigan during a ceremony at the Port Authority of Guam April 12, 2011.

Piti, GUAM – Coast Guard Cmdr. Yuri Graves, the deputy commander of Sector Guam, officially recognizes Edward Ratigan with the Meritorious Public Service Award during a ceremony at the Port Authority of Guam, April 12, 2011. Ratigan was honored for his courageous efforts while responding to a distress call from the crew of the Majestic Blue, June 14, 2010. 
The Majestic Blue was sinking more than 90 miles away when Ratigan responded, arriving first on scene in time to save 22 fishermen.
